Manufacturing Process:
Solar water pumps are typically composed of photovoltaic (PV) panels or modules that convert sunlight into electricity. The PV panels generate direct current (DC), which is then fed into a controller/regulator unit. This unit regulates the voltage and ensures optimal performance even on cloudy days. The DC power fro Renewable Energy Water Pump m the regulator is supplied to a motor that drives an impeller or piston assembly attached to a centrifugal or positive displacement pump.

Advantages:
1.Energy Efficiency: Solar water pumps ensure maximum utilization of available sunlight by converting it directly into useful mechanical work without any intermediate steps.
2.Cost Savings: Operating costs are significantly reduced since no fuel or electricity consumption is required after installation.
3.Low Maintenance:Solar-powered systems have fewer moving parts compared to conventional pumping systems, resulting in lower maintenance needs and longer overall lifespan.
4.Remote Operations:Setup even in remote areas where grid connectivity is limited or no solar water pump nexistent allows access to reliable water supply.
5.No Noise Pollution: Sol solar water pump ar water pumps operate silently, making them ideal for noise-sensitive environments such as residential areas or wildlife habitats.
Usage Methods:
Solar water pumps find applications in various sectors, including agriculture, rural development projects, livestock watering systems, irrigation schemes, and domestic water supplies. These pumps are particularly use Clean Energy Water Pump ful in regions with abundant sunlight but limited access to electricity or fossil fuels.
How to Select the Right Product:
1.Determine Water Demand: Evaluate the volume of water required per day and consider factors like seasonal variations and peak demands.
2.Panel Capacity:Solar panel capacity should match the pump’s power requirements according to daily sun exposure.
3.Water Pump Type:Choose between surface-mounted centrifugal or submersible solar water pumps based on the source of water (well/borehole/surface).
4.Warranty and Af
ter-sales Service: Ensure that manufacturers provide warranties on key components and offer readily available after-sales maintenance services.
